🌿 Two Types of Mesenchymal Stem Cells — What’s the Difference and What Do We Choose?

We work exclusively with mesenchymal stem cells (MSCs) — but it’s important to understand that they come in two types:

1️⃣ The patient’s own stem cells
2️⃣ Donor stem cells, most often derived from umbilical cord tissue

Both types provide anti-inflammatory and immune-regulating effects — especially after laboratory expansion, which we always perform to enhance their therapeutic activity.

✅ Donor MSCs tend to produce a stronger anti-inflammatory effect at the beginning of treatment, although they are gradually cleared from the body.

✅ The patient’s own MSCs are never rejected and may contribute to tissue regeneration.

We apply special methods to prolong the activity of donor cells in the body, helping extend and strengthen the therapeutic effect.

The choice of cell type depends on the patient’s condition, diagnosis, and treatment goals.

❗Direct Injection of Oncolytic Viruses into the Tumor

In some cases, if imaging shows that a needle can be safely inserted, we use a targeted method: injecting oncolytic viruses directly into the tumor using CT or ultrasound guidance.

🎯 The goal? To activate the immune system right at the tumor site.
This can lead not only to a local immune attack, but also to a systemic response — where the body may begin to fight distant metastases, even if they weren’t treated directly.

❗ Mesenchymal stem cells (MSCs) are increasingly being used in the treatment of multiple sclerosis and other autoimmune conditions 🍀

But before choosing this type of therapy, it's essential to understand how it works — and whether it's the right option for you.

WHAT TYPES OF STEM CELLS ARE USED FOR MS?

✅ Donor-derived (allogeneic) — obtained from another person, most often from umbilical cord tissue. These cells can reduce chronic inflammation and help regulate immune system function.

✅ Autologous (your own) — harvested from the patient’s own body, typically from bone marrow. These cells not only reduce inflammation but can also turn into oligodendrocytes — the cells that produce myelin, the protective sheath around nerve fibers. This makes them a more promising option for treating multiple sclerosis.
